is make-money.one legitimate or a scam?Why is the trust score of make-money.one very low?
The website “make-money.one” claims to offer a way to earn money through a mobile app. However, several aspects of the website raise red flags:
1. Lack of Information: The website provides very little information about how the app actually works to generate income. There are no details about the business model, revenue sources, or how users can earn money.
2. Unrealistic Claims: The website makes generic claims about earning money on your phone, which is a common tactic used by many scam websites. Legitimate businesses usually provide specific details about how users can earn money.
3. Privacy Policy: The privacy policy mentions the collection of various types of personal and financial information, including email addresses, user IDs, payment information, app activity, device IDs, and geo-location. This level of data collection is excessive for a simple money-making app and raises concerns about privacy and security.
4. Legal Basis for Data Processing: The privacy policy mentions that the app may rely on explicit consent for processing personal data. However, it’s unclear how this consent is obtained from users, and the lack of transparency is a red flag.
5. Data Sharing: The policy states that collected data may be disclosed to affiliates, agents, contractors, and even law enforcement. This raises concerns about the security and confidentiality of user information.
6. Storage and International Transfers: The policy mentions that user information may be transferred to several countries, including the United Arab Emirates, Germany, the United States, and others. This raises questions about data protection and compliance with international privacy laws.
7. Use of Third-Party Services: The website lists a large number of third-party services and providers, including Google Analytics, Meta, Kochava, Ayet, Lootably, Fyber, IronSource, Tapjoy, and others. While the use of third-party services is common, the extensive list raises concerns about the sharing and processing of user data.
8. Child Safety: The website claims that the app is intended for users aged 16 and above, but it’s important to note that legitimate money-making apps usually have strict age verification and compliance measures.
9. Lack of Contact Information: The website does not provide a physical address or direct contact information, which is unusual for a legitimate business.
10. Vague Business Entity: The website mentions a company called “Performance Spark Media FZ-LLC” based in Ras Al Khaimah, United Arab Emirates. However, the lack of detailed information about this company and its operations is a concern.
Based on these observations, the website “make-money.one” exhibits several characteristics commonly associated with scam or untrustworthy websites. It’s important to exercise caution and thoroughly research any platform that claims to offer easy ways to make money, especially if it involves sharing sensitive personal and financial information.”

How to Stay Safe Online
Here are 10 basic security tips to help you avoid malware and protect your devices.
Use a good antivirus and keep it up-to-date
It's essential to use a quality antivirus to stay ahead of cyber threats. Free solutions are available for all devices that protect against malware and viruses.
Keep software and operating systems up-to-date
Software companies regularly update platforms to fix vulnerabilities. Update your operating system, browsers, and apps whenever prompted.
Be careful when installing programs and apps
Pay close attention to installation options and uncheck agreements for toolbars and add-ons. Take care in every stage of the process.
Install an ad blocker
Advertisements can sometimes spread malware. Use ad blockers that stop malicious ads, images, and other content that antivirus might miss.
Be careful what you download
Research before downloading freeware or apps that might carry hidden malware. Be especially cautious with torrent files.
Be alert for people trying to trick you
Stay vigilant against phishing and social engineering. Remembxer that banks never ask for passwords, and familiar names don't make messages trustworthy.
Back up your data
Backup frequently and verify that backups can be restored. Use external drives disconnected from your computer or trusted cloud services.
Choose strong passwords
Use unique passwords for all accounts. Avoid personal information and enable two-factor authentication (2FA) when possible.
Be careful where you click
Exercise caution with links or attachments from unknown sources. These could contain malware or phishing scams.
Don't use pirated software
Avoid key generators, file sharing programs, and cracked software. These are often compromised with malware or crypto-miners.
